Hood River Launching and Trailer Storage

 

Boats are launched from the two lane ramp at the head of the visitor dock at the Port of Hood River marina. Launching and trailer storage is free. Trailers may be stored in the parking lot adjacent to the launch ramp or in the gravel lot to the south of the marina offices (bottom left in the photo below).
